Karate courses are readily available for youngsters as young as 3 or 4 years old. At this age, classes are commonly developed to be lively and engaging, concentrating on basic motor skills and initial techniques - Salisbury Karate. As youngsters expand older, they can explore advanced elements of martial arts. When your child begins martial arts, they will certainly need a karate gi, which is a conventional attire.


Karate courses commonly last in between 30 to 60 mins, depending on the age team and the dojo's framework. Younger youngsters usually have much shorter courses to maintain their interest concentrated. https://maps.roadtrippers.com/people/lgcymrt1arts?lng=-98.35000&lat=39.50000&z=3.30945.

To promote efficient learning, karate teachers should adjust their teaching approaches to the developing needs of each age team. More youthful youngsters benefit from a lively method with short, interesting drills that construct sychronisation and discipline. As pupils expand, trainers can present a lot more structured techniques, goal-setting, and protection applications fit to their cognitive and physical abilities.
